The Basics of Half Tattoo Sleeve Designs

Half

First things first, what exactly is a half tattoo sleeve design? Well, as the name suggests, it's a type of tattoo that covers only half of your arm. Typically, this means starting at the top of your shoulder and ending somewhere around the elbow. Of course, there's no hard and fast rule when it comes to the exact size or placement of a half tattoo sleeve design – it all depends on your personal preferences and the artist you're working with.

Popular Half Tattoo Sleeve Design Themes

Flower

When it comes to half tattoo sleeve designs, there are a few themes that tend to be particularly popular. One of these is floral designs. Flowers have long been a popular tattoo subject, and for good reason – they're beautiful, versatile, and can be customized in countless ways. Whether you opt for realistic roses or more abstract, watercolor-inspired blooms, a floral half tattoo sleeve design is sure to turn heads.

Half

Of course, floral designs aren't for everyone. If you're looking for something a bit more masculine, there are plenty of half tattoo sleeve designs that fit the bill. For example, tribal patterns, geometric shapes, and animal designs (such as wolves or eagles) are all popular choices for men's half tattoo sleeve designs.

The Benefits of Half Tattoo Sleeve Designs

Half

So, why choose a half tattoo sleeve design over a full sleeve or smaller tattoo? Well, there are several benefits to this particular style. For one thing, a half tattoo sleeve allows you to show off your ink without being too overwhelming. It's also a great option if you work in a professional setting and need to cover up your tattoos from time to time. Plus, since it covers a relatively small area, a half tattoo sleeve design typically takes less time and money to complete than a full sleeve.

Preparing for Your Appointment

Half

Once you've found an artist you're comfortable with, it's time to prepare for your appointment. This means taking good care of your skin in the days and weeks leading up to your tattoo, avoiding alcohol and other substances that can thin your blood, and being well-rested on the day of your appointment. It's also a good idea to bring along some snacks and water to keep you fueled during the tattooing process.

Caring for Your Tattoo

Tattoo

Once your half tattoo sleeve design is complete, it's important to take good care of it to ensure it heals properly. This means following your artist's aftercare instructions to the letter, which may include keeping the area clean and dry, applying moisturizer regularly, and avoiding direct sunlight and swimming for a period of time. With proper care, your half tattoo sleeve design will hopefully look just as beautiful years down the line as it did on the day you got it.

People Also Ask About Half Tattoo Sleeve Designs:

1. How long does it take to complete a half tattoo sleeve design?
As Ryan Ashley DiCristina, I can say that the length of time it takes to complete a half tattoo sleeve design depends on several factors such as the complexity of the design, the size of the tattoo, and the skill level of the artist. On average, it can take anywhere from 15 to 30 hours to complete a half sleeve tattoo.

2. What are some popular designs for half tattoo sleeves?
There are many popular designs for half tattoo sleeves, including floral patterns, geometric shapes, tribal designs, and portraits. As an artist, I always encourage clients to choose a design that is personal to them and has significant meaning.

3. Is it painful to get a half tattoo sleeve?
Yes, getting a half tattoo sleeve can be painful, especially around bony areas such as the elbow and wrist. However, the pain level varies from person to person. It also depends on the individual's pain tolerance and the location of the tattoo.

4. How do I choose the right artist for my half tattoo sleeve?
Choosing the right artist for your half tattoo sleeve requires research and careful consideration. Look at the artist's portfolio to ensure they have experience with the type of design you want. Also, read reviews from previous clients and ask for recommendations from friends or family members who have had tattoos done by the artist.

5. Can I still wear short-sleeved shirts with a half tattoo sleeve?
Yes, you can still wear short-sleeved shirts with a half tattoo sleeve. However, it is important to keep in mind that the tattoo may show depending on the placement and size of the design. It is always best to consider the visibility of the tattoo when choosing clothing.
